False Belief: Higher Output Always Equals Better Riding
Many riders believe that boosting performance is the ultimate goal of bike customization. However, this is one of the most harmful misconceptions. A well-tuned motorcycle focuses on rideability, not just raw numbers.
- Torque characteristics matter more than peak horsepower for practical performance
- Over-tuning can reduce reliability and increase maintenance costs
- Proper fuel management through ECU programming is more important than displacement
- Weight distribution and handling determine rideability more than horsepower figures
Common Tuning Errors to Avoid
Our experience serving riders throughout the region has shown us that riders often overlook critical factors. When you're considering motorcycle engine tuning, avoid these frequent mistakes:
Ignoring Air-Fuel Ratio Balance: One of the most critical motorcycle tuning facts is that correct air-fuel ratios determines everything. Whether you're doing motorcycle carburetor tuning, getting this wrong can cause reliability issues. Our expert consultations always start with proper diagnostics.
Neglecting Supporting Modifications: Many riders believe they can add performance parts without addressing other components. This is among the most common motorcycle tuning misconceptions. A optimized system requires integrated changes to exhaust designs and beyond.
